**Ticket GRV-218: staging env misconfigured for Graphvine**

Staging is rendering an empty dependency graph again. Turns out someone copied the prod `.env` but left `GRAPH_SOURCE=local`, so the visualizer never hits the package index. For future maintainers: staging should use `GRAPH_SOURCE=remote` and `INDEX_REGION=fenwick-east`. Also, the remote index requires an access token, which belongs in the env file right after this line.

sealed setting: ARCHIVE_KEY3=8d0

Quick intro for the sync: Bucketeer is our A/B assignment service. It hashes user IDs into deterministic buckets, so assignments are stable across sessions — no sticky storage needed. New experiments go through the config review queue first. Dashboards, current experiment list, and the allocation guide all live at:

dashboard of kafof-tahaf = https://confluence.tolvaqsys.internal/projects/browse/display/a1250987

Subject: Handover — Draftbird undo bug

Hey Priya, passing the baton. The undo/redo desync in Draftbird only shows up after a paste-then-group combo; repro steps are in the ticket. Fix is merged but not released, so the release manager should hold the train until QA signs off. If anything regresses overnight, the editor team can be reached below.

escalation mailbox, bafog-fafog: ulador@paliqlabs.internal